Knights Defeat Bob Jones to Advance to Final Four

In a nail-biting contest that showcased the resilience and determination of the Knights, Spurgeon College secured a dramatic 99-97 victory over Bob Jones University in the National Tournament on March 13, 2025. The win marks another significant milestone in what has become a historic season for Spurgeon College basketball.

Overcoming First-Half Deficit
The Knights found themselves trailing 56-50 at halftime despite a remarkable 21-point first-half performance from Jack Chamberlin. Spurgeon's defense struggled to contain Bob Jones University's offensive attack, which shot an impressive 51.35% from the field in the opening period.

Second-Half Surge
Showing the heart of champions, Spurgeon rallied in the second half behind a balanced offensive effort. Drew Middleton caught fire, scoring 14 points in the second half including four crucial three-pointers. Diego Sanchez provided a spark off the bench with 10 second-half points, while Zion Bourgeois added 8 points on perfect 3-for-3 shooting to fuel the comeback.

Standout Performances
The Knights were led by several outstanding individual efforts:

  • Jack Chamberlin recorded a double-double with 25 points and 13 rebounds
  • Drew Middleton connected on five three-pointers en route to 17 points
  • Joseph Allen contributed 13 points, including 8-for-10 from the free-throw line
  • Bohden Duffield orchestrated the offense with 6 assists while adding 10 points
  • The bench provided crucial support with 23 points

Defensive Adjustments
After allowing 56 first-half points, Spurgeon's defense tightened considerably in the second half, holding Bob Jones to just 41 points on 35.48% shooting. The Knights' ability to make critical stops in the closing minutes proved decisive in securing the victory.

Looking Ahead
This thrilling victory advances Spurgeon College further in the National Tournament, continuing what has already been a historic season that includes the program's first-ever Regional Championship and an impressive winning streak.
